One of my favorites NYC summer activities is Williamsburg’s very own SummerScreen. The event first launched in the summer of 2005. Over 3,000 people swept McCarren Park Pool to watch its first film, Do the Right Thing. Since then, it has been a highly popularized and expected gathering.
There are many other outdoor/rooftop film scenes such as Bryant Park’s Summer Film Festival. However, what separates SummerScreen from the rest is not only the great variety of movies, but also its engaging line-up. SummerScreen first entertains its guest with live bands. Many people come to the park as early as 5pm, claiming their spots with blankets and beach chairs. Thus, audiences are geared up with amazing music of diverse styles, starting at 6pm. As the sun begins to set, viewers are then primed with episodes of short TV shows such as Black Dynamite. SummerScreen also surrounds you with amazing food and drink vendors, present before and throughout the show, selling yummy treats.

McCarren Park hosts SummerScreen at the corner of Bedford Ave and North 12th street.
This year, SummerScreen is getting interactive. Now you can vote for the film playing on August 15th. Vote for your favorite movie through Facebook.
SummerScreen is 100% free; but this year they are selling VIP tickets, which will guarantee buyers great seats, up close and centered, along with coupons to use at any of the vendors, two drink tickets and dessert from the Coolhaus truck.
VIP will also grant you access to the after party on the King and Grove roof deck just across the street from McCarren Park.
